So those are the best laptops for 3D modeling, Solidworks, AutoCAD or Maya. What are the things and features we looked for while choose them?

Quad core processor with 8 minimum threads – It should have a quad core i7 or i5 with support for eight or more threads. This allows the application to do multiple tasks at the same time. We suggest going for latest 7th or 8th generation quad core i5 / i7 processors for best end user experience.

Discrete Nvidia graphics card – All 3D modeling applications require you to have a laptop with dedicated graphics card for optimum performance. All of these apps use the discrete GPU for rendering and that is why it is important to have a discrete GPU onboard for best performance. The best one are the latest Nvidia Pascal series that include RTX 2060/ 2070/ 2080/ 3080 but if you are a starter or intermediate, something like Vega 7 by AMD will do just fine too.

Full HD screen – High resolution screen is important while working on a 3D modeling application. Full HD screen shows you much more information and data at a time so you are able to squeeze in all the toolbars. We highly suggest going for a full HD laptop over a 4k quad HD laptop as 4k displays do not play well with windows 10 and text becomes way too tiny for daily use.
